A John Deere Z375R belt diagram is a schematic diagram that illustrates the routing of all the belts on the John Deere Z375R mower deck. These diagrams help to ensure that the belts are installed correctly, and that they are routed in a way that will maximize their lifespan.
Belt diagrams are an important tool for anyone who services or repairs John Deere mowers. They can help to prevent costly mistakes, and can ensure that the mower is running at its peak performance.

2. Routing
The routing of the belts on a John Deere Z375R mower deck is crucial for its proper functioning and longevity. The John Deere Z375R belt diagram provides a clear visual guide to the correct routing of the belts, ensuring that they are installed in a way that prevents costly mistakes.
Incorrectly routed belts can cause a number of problems, including:
- Premature wear and tear: Belts that are not routed correctly are more likely to rub against other components, causing them to wear out prematurely.
- Misalignment: Incorrectly routed belts can cause the mower deck to become misaligned, which can lead to uneven cutting and scalping.
- Damage to the mower deck: In severe cases, incorrectly routed belts can damage the mower deck itself.
By following the John Deere Z375R belt diagram, you can avoid these costly mistakes and ensure that your mower deck is operating at its best.
